Popular throwback in the historical India House with steaks, a wine cellar & an adjoining cafe.
This highly-rated New York City establishment, recognized with a 4.5-star average from over 1700 reviews, provides an experience steeped in old-school charm. Diners consistently praise the ambiance, often describing it as a moody, cinematic space illuminated by soft, golden lighting and rich dark wood. It’s a versatile setting, equally suited for an intimate date night or a polished business engagement. The menu features well-executed classics, with particular acclaim for dishes like the Beef Wellington, noted for its balanced flavors and perfectly prepared components, including tender beef and crisp pastry. With a price range indicating a premium experience and a selection of cocktails available, this restaurant offers a memorable dining occasion. It's also a great option for groups and accepts reservations.

Harry’s has that old-school New York charm wrapped in a modern, moody glow dark wood tables, soft golden table lamps, and ceiling lights that make the whole place feel cinematic. It’s the kind of spot that works perfectly for both a date night and a classy business dinner. I ordered the Beef Wellington, and honestly, it was beautifully balanced. The puff pastry was perfectly crisp without being dry, the beef stayed tender and juicy at a perfect medium-rare, and the subtle truffle aroma in the sauce tied everything together. Served on a silver platter, it looked as good as it tasted. If you’re a steakhouse lover, their prime ribeye or NY strip is also worth trying the char and crust are spot on, and you can really tell they know their meat. Finished off with the bread pudding topped with vanilla ice cream 🍨 warm, creamy, not overly sweet, and the perfect cozy ending to the meal. ✨ In short: elegant, nostalgic, and delicious!! a place that truly captures the spirit of classic New York dining done right. Harry’s is a true NYC standout. Their wine list of over 3,000 bottles is world-class, and the Beef Wellington was cooked to perfection. The whipped potatoes were creamy, and the asparagus was fresh and crisp. Exceptional dining all around.
